Abstract

The utility model discloses a medical film-coated rubber plug for solving the leakage problem of a seal, which relates to the technical field of rubber plugs and comprises a plug block and a plug head arranged at the lower end of the plug block, wherein a leakage-proof component comprises a button and a fixed panel arranged at one end of the button, an operator puts the plug head into a bottle mouth, then presses the button to move downwards, the button drives the fixed panel to slide on a threaded rod and simultaneously drives a piston to move in an installation groove, air in the installation groove is extruded into an air outlet chamber, the pressure of the installation groove is higher than that of the air outlet chamber, the air in the air outlet chamber can be extruded into a rubber air bag, the action is repeated until the rubber air bag is popped out from a groove and tightly attached to the inner side wall of the medicine bottle mouth, the liquid can be sealed and locked in the medicine bottle without flowing out, and the rubber air bag is suitable for medicine bottles with various specifications by changing the size of the rubber air bag, simple operation and wide application range.

Referring to fig. 1, a medical film coated rubber stopper for solving leakage problem in sealing comprises a stopper block 1 and a stopper 2 installed at the lower end of the stopper block 1, wherein an anti-corrosion layer 3021 and an anti-sticking layer 3022 are also arranged on the surface of the stopper 2, an installation groove 11 is formed in the inner cavity of the stopper block 1, a leakage prevention assembly 3 is arranged on the upper surface of the stopper block 1, a fixing assembly 4 is arranged at one end of the leakage prevention assembly 3, and a groove 21 is formed in the side surface of the stopper block 2.
Referring to fig. 1-3 and 5, the liquid leakage preventing assembly 3 includes a button 31 and a fixing panel 32 installed at one end of the button 31, a piston 33 is installed at a lower end of the button 31, a spring 34 is installed at a lower end of the piston 33, an air inlet pipe 35 is installed at one end of the installation groove 11, one end of the air inlet pipe 35 is connected with a first one-way valve 36 in a penetrating manner, the first one-way valve 36 is used for absorbing air from the outside only in a one-way manner, an air outlet pipe 37 is installed at the other end of the installation groove 11, one end of the air outlet pipe 37 is connected with a second one-way valve 38 in a penetrating manner, the second one-way valve 38 only enables air to enter the air outlet chamber 39 in a one-way manner, the liquid leakage preventing assembly 3 is further provided with an air outlet chamber 39 connected with the air outlet pipe 37, an air injection pipe 301 is installed at a lower end of the air outlet chamber 39, one end of the air injection pipe 301 is connected with a rubber airbag 302, and the rubber airbag 302 includes an anti-corrosion layer 3021 and an anti-sticking layer 3022 installed at one side of the anti-corrosion layer 3021.
Specifically, through anticorrosive coating 3021 and antiseized layer 3022's effect, the surface that prevents chock plug 2 and rubber gasbag 302 is stained with the liquid medicine and is prevented by the liquid medicine corruption, and the other end of going out air chamber 39 is connected with the pipeline 303 that loses heart, and the one end of the pipeline 303 that loses heart is provided with screw block 304, screw block 304 and the pipeline 303 threaded connection that loses heart.
It should be noted that, an operator puts the plug 2 into the bottle mouth, then presses the button 31 to move downward, the button 31 drives the fixing panel 32 to slide on the threaded rod 41, and simultaneously drives the piston 33 to move in the mounting groove 11, so as to extrude the air in the mounting groove 11 into the air outlet chamber 39, at this time, the pressure in the mounting groove 11 is greater than the pressure in the air outlet chamber 39, the air in the air outlet chamber 39 can be extruded into the rubber air bag 302, and the operation is repeated until the rubber air bag 302 is ejected from the groove 21 and tightly attached to the inner side wall of the medicine bottle mouth, so that the medicine bottle can be locked in a liquid-tight manner, no liquid flows out, and the size of the rubber air bag is changed, so that the medicine bottle is suitable for medicine bottles of various specifications, and the application range is wide.
Referring to fig. 2 and 4, the fixing assembly 4 includes a threaded rod 41 and a threaded sleeve 42 penetrating through one end of the threaded rod 41, the threaded rod 41 is fixedly connected to the plug 1, the threaded sleeve 42 is threadedly connected to the threaded rod 41, one end of the threaded sleeve 42 is fixedly connected to a rotating rod 43, the fixing assembly 4 includes a threaded rod 41 and a threaded sleeve 42 penetrating through one end of the threaded rod 41, and one end of the threaded sleeve 42 is fixedly connected to the rotating rod 43.
When rubber gasbag 302 is popped out from recess 21 and tightly pastes the medicine bottleneck, drive rotary rod 43 downstream when rotatory rotary rod 43 pivoted, it is fixed to lock fixed panel 32, prevent to extrude button 31 once more and make in the air admission goes out air cavity 39, when the rubber buffer is taken out to needs, the operator only need rotate screw block 304, make screw block 304 break away from disappointing pipeline 303, emit the gas in rubber gasbag 302 inner chamber, can take out the rubber buffer, moreover, the operation is simple, time and labor are saved.
